SEI at UNEA-7: topics to watch

Stockholm Environment Institute (SEI) will participate in the upcoming seventh session of the United Nations Environment Assembly (UNEA-7) on December 8 – 12, after participating in the seventh session of the Open-ended Committee of Permanent Representatives (OECPR-7) on December 1 – 5. 

Published on 2 December 2025

The SEI delegation will offer expert commentary on climate resilience, adaptation, chemicals, waste, circularity, environmental governance, emerging technologies (AI), gender inclusion and Indigenous knowledge  key issues under this year’s theme: “advancing sustainable solutions for a resilient planet.
